Frequently Asked Questions

What are the typical salary ranges for Implements Company Asset Protection Procedures roles?
Salaries vary significantly based on experience, location, and the complexity of assets protected. Entry-level Loss Prevention Specialists might see $45,000 - $65,000. Mid-career Asset Protection Analysts or Security Managers often earn $70,000 - $110,000, especially with expertise in advanced surveillance systems or data analytics for fraud detection. Senior roles, such as Director of Global Asset Protection, can command $120,000 - $200,000+, reflecting leadership in enterprise-wide risk management and compliance with regulations like GDPR or SOX.
What key skills and certifications are essential for a career in Implements Company Asset Protection Procedures?
Essential skills include robust risk assessment methodologies, incident investigation techniques, proficiency with physical security technologies (e.g., Genetec, LenelS2 access control, advanced CCTV analytics), data analysis for identifying anomalies, and comprehensive knowledge of loss prevention strategies. Strong communication and critical thinking are also vital. Relevant certifications like the ASIS International's Certified Protection Professional (CPP) or Physical Security Professional (PSP), the Loss Prevention Foundation's LPQ/LPC, or the Certified Fraud Examiner (CFE) are highly valued by employers.
Can professionals in Implements Company Asset Protection Procedures roles work remotely?
While many roles, particularly those involving physical security operations, incident response, or on-site investigations, require a strong physical presence, remote work options are growing. Positions focused on data analysis for fraud detection, security policy development, risk assessment, or remote monitoring of security systems often offer hybrid or fully remote flexibility. Roles that leverage AI-driven surveillance analytics or supply chain risk management software are increasingly adaptable to remote collaboration.
What are the typical career progression paths for someone in Implements Company Asset Protection Procedures?
A common path begins as a Loss Prevention Specialist or Security Analyst, progressing to roles like Loss Prevention Manager, Corporate Investigator, or Security Operations Manager. Further advancement can lead to Regional Director of Asset Protection, Head of Global Security, or even Chief Security Officer (CSO). Specialization is also key, with paths into areas like supply chain security, digital forensics for fraud, or enterprise risk management, often leveraging advanced analytical tools and compliance expertise.
What are the emerging trends impacting the field of Implements Company Asset Protection Procedures?
Key trends include the increased adoption of AI and machine learning for predictive analytics in fraud detection and risk assessment, integrating physical security systems with cybersecurity platforms for a unified threat posture, and leveraging IoT devices for enhanced asset tracking and supply chain visibility. Data privacy regulations like GDPR and CCPA are also driving stricter data handling procedures within asset protection. Furthermore, a growing emphasis on supply chain resilience and security, often utilizing blockchain or advanced tracking technologies, is redefining how companies protect assets from origin to destination.
